In a pivotal demonstration that underscores the evolving landscape of military technology, the Pentagon unveiled its latest advancements in laser weaponry. On Tuesday, high-ranking officials, including Defense Secretary Pete Hegseth, observed the practical applications of high-energy lasers and powerful microwave weapons, marking a significant step forward in the United States' defense capabilities.
Understanding Laser Weaponry
Laser weapons represent a revolutionary approach to modern combat, employing concentrated light to disable or destroy targets with precision. Unlike traditional munitions, these systems offer several strategic advantages:
- Cost-effective: Laser systems significantly reduce operational costs by using energy instead of expendable ordnance.
- Precision targeting: High-energy lasers are capable of striking specific targets with remarkable accuracy, minimizing collateral damage.
- Rapid response: These systems can engage multiple targets in quick succession, offering a tactical edge on the battlefield.
The Pentagon's Latest Demonstration
The recent demonstration involved a series of live tests showcasing the capabilities of these advanced weapon systems. High-energy lasers successfully intercepted drones, while microwave weapons disabled electronic equipment. This event not only highlighted the technology's functional prowess but also its potential implications for future military engagements.
